The Gutenberg Revolution: How Printing Changed the Course of History Subclass_ISLAM Gary spent his youth immersingIn 1450, all Europe's books were handcopied and amounted to only a few thousand. By 1500 they were printed, and numbered in their millions. The invention of one man Johann Gutenberg had caused a revolution. Printing by movable type was a discovery waiting to happen.
